You will be part of a dynamic and friendly team; you will be responsible for scheduling all the electrical engineer’s work. You will ensure that all tasks are allocated to engineers so that SLA’s are met and kept to, updating the engineers schedule sheet. Dealing with incoming calls and emails quickly and efficiently to ensure the highest quality standards are kept and any other admin duties required. A successful candidate should be able to demonstrate strong attention to detail along with the ability to discover potential risks
•Liaise with engineers in relation to schedules
•Scheduling & Booking works for Electrical engineers
•Attend daily conference calls with electrical team
•Ensuring all client instructions are logged
•Dealing with incoming calls and emails
•Allocation of jobs to engineers and sub-contractors
•Recording all communication and arrangements on our in house system
•Chasing for updates and paperwork
Communication with colleagues/team - keeping them informed of client changes/requirements
•Deliver outstanding customer service by responding promptly, remaining courteous and professional at all times
•Escalate any issues
•Creating quotes & updating quote tracker
•Checking Jobs are complete and all paperwork received
•Chase for NIC/EIC certification and ensure certs are attached to jobs
•Completion of RAMS
•Creation of reports & Certificates
•Monitor paperwork for quality
